Building a professional website is one of the most important steps for businesses that want to establish a strong online presence. A well-built website helps companies attract customers, showcase services, and build credibility. For many businesses, hiring a freelance web developer is a practical solution that provides flexibility, expertise, and cost efficiency compared to hiring an in-house team.
Before starting the hiring process, it is important to define the goals of the website. Some businesses need a simple marketing site to present their services, while others require more complex platforms such as e-commerce stores, booking systems, or custom web applications.
Understanding the project scope helps determine what type of developer and skill set is required.
Reviewing a developer’s portfolio is one of the most effective ways to evaluate their capabilities. A strong portfolio should include examples of real websites, showing different layouts, responsive design, and functionality across devices. By visiting live projects, businesses can assess loading speed, usability, and overall design quality. This provides a clearer picture of how the developer approaches real-world projects.
Communication is another important factor when hiring a freelance web developer. Clear communication ensures that both the client and the developer understand the project requirements, timelines, and expected deliverables. Developers who ask thoughtful questions and explain technical decisions usually create smoother project workflows and fewer misunderstandings during development.
Budget planning also plays a major role when hiring freelancers. Web development costs can vary depending on the complexity of the project, the number of pages, integrations, and design requirements. Some developers work on hourly rates, while others offer fixed-price services based on predefined project scope. Businesses often prefer fixed-price projects because they provide clearer expectations regarding costs and delivery timelines.
Another important step is defining the project scope before development begins. The scope should include the number of pages, required features, integrations, revisions, and the delivery schedule. When the scope is clearly defined at the beginning, it reduces the chances of unexpected changes that can increase both cost and development time.
Businesses should also confirm ownership and access to the website after project completion. This includes access to hosting accounts, domain registration, and content management systems. Ensuring proper ownership allows businesses to update or expand their website without limitations in the future.
Hiring a freelance web developer can be a highly effective way to build a professional website without the overhead of a full-time team. By reviewing portfolios, defining project goals, and maintaining clear communication, businesses can create successful website projects that support long-term growth.
A structured freelance marketplace can simplify this process by allowing businesses to compare services, review deliverables, and hire developers based on clearly defined offers and pricing. This approach helps reduce confusion and allows companies to focus on building websites that support their business goals.